Abstract
Abstract: The production of Υ(nS) mesons (n = 1, 2, 3) in pPb and Pbp collisions at a centre-of-mass energy per nucleon pair √ sNN = 8.16 TeV is measured by the LHCb experiment, using a data sample corresponding to an integrated luminosity of 31.8 nb−1 . The Υ(nS) mesons are reconstructed through their decays into two opposite-sign muons. The measurements comprise the differential production cross-sections of the Υ(1S) and Υ(2S) states, their forward-to-backward ratios and nuclear modification factors. The measurements are performed as a function of the transverse momentum pT and rapidity in the nucleon-nucleon centre-of-mass frame y ∗ of the Υ(nS) states, in the kinematic range pT < 25 GeV/c and 1.5 < y∗ < 4.0 (−5.0 < y∗ < −2.5) for pPb (Pbp) collisions. In addition, production cross-sections for Υ(3S) are measured integrated over phase space and the production ratios between all three Υ(nS) states are determined. Suppression for bottomonium in proton-lead collisions is observed, which is particularly visible in the ratios. The results are compared to theoretical models.
